Guide: Fixing the Issue of Apps Not Displaying Vietnamese Currency on App Store
This issue arises because your phone is set to a country other than Vietnam. Therefore, here's what you need to do to fix the problem:
Step 1. Go to Settings on your device > select iTunes & App Store > then choose your account and select View Apple ID.
Step 2. Now, click on Country/Region > then select Change Country or Region.
Step 3. Here, scroll down and choose the country Vietnam > press Agree to confirm the change.
Step 4. Now, reopen the App Store and go to the section for paid apps & games. The currency has been changed to Vietnamese Dong.
